Key Components and Design

Mixing vessels are usually made of stainless steel (such as 304 stainless steel), which has good corrosion resistance and can adapt to the chemical properties of various powder materials to avoid material contamination. The capacity of the container varies from a few liters for laboratories or small batch production to thousands of liters for large-scale industrial production.

The shape of the container is generally U-shaped or square. Cylindrical containers are conducive to the circulation of materials and reduce the dead corners of mixing; square containers have more advantages in space utilization and are convenient for installing auxiliary equipment. The interior of the container is usually designed with a smooth surface to prevent powder residue, and some containers have a certain tilt angle at the bottom to facilitate the complete discharge of materials after mixing.
